Warm up your kitchen with the aromatic allure of Moroccan Lentil Soup with Chickpeas, a comforting dish brimming with bold spices and wholesome ingredients. This vegan and gluten-free soup combines tender red lentils, hearty chickpeas, and vibrant vegetables, all simmered in a fragrant blend of cumin, coriander, cinnamon, and smoked paprika. A splash of fresh lemon juice and cilantro adds a zesty brightness to perfectly balance the earthy, spiced broth. Ready in under an hour, this nutrient-packed soup is not only easy to make but also incredibly versatileβserve it with crusty bread or over a bed of rice for a satisfying meal. Perfect for weeknight dinners or meal prep, this Moroccan-inspired recipe is sure to become a favorite in your kitchen.
Heat olive oil in a large soup pot over medium heat.
Add the diced onion and sautΓ© for 4β5 minutes until softened and translucent.
Stir in the minced garlic, diced carrots, and celery. Cook for another 3β4 minutes while stirring occasionally.
Add the cumin, coriander, cinnamon, smoked paprika, turmeric, and red pepper flakes to the pot. Stir the spices into the vegetables and cook for 1 minute to release their aromas.
Pour in the rinsed red lentils, drained chickpeas, canned diced tomatoes (with their juice), vegetable broth, and water. Stir to combine.
Bring the soup to a boil, then reduce the heat to low and cover. Simmer for 25β30 minutes, or until the lentils are tender and the soup has thickened.
Stir in the chopped fresh cilantro and fresh lemon juice for a bright, fresh flavor. Season with salt and black pepper to taste.
Remove the soup from heat and let it sit for 5 minutes before serving. Ladle into bowls and garnish with additional cilantro if desired.
Serve warm with crusty bread or over a bed of rice for a complete meal.
